Frank Easterbrook
Frank Easterbrook has served as a judge on the United States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it since 1985 and served as Chief Judge from 2006 to 2013. Before his judicial appointment, Easterbrook was a prominent legal scholar and attorney, teaching at the University of Chicago Law School and working in the Solicitor General's office.
